Softwareentwickler
- Verfügbarkeit einsehen
- 0 Referenzen
- 90€/Stunde
- 80797 München
- Weltweit
- de | en
- 28.08.2024
Kurzvorstellung
Erfahrung in der Toolentwicklung
Erfahrung in der Testautomatisierung
Trainer für Python
Qualifikationen
Projekt‐ & Berufserfahrung
9/2021 – 6/2024
Tätigkeitsbeschreibung
Weiterentwicklung der Testautomatisierung basierend auf Java und demRobotframework zum Test von high-end Filmkameras
Testdurchführung mit Jenkins, CI/CD mit Gitlab
Neuentwicklung der Testautomatisierung mit Hilfe von Pytest
Git, Java (allg.), Jenkins, Junit, Linux Entwicklung, Python, SSH (Secure Shell), Json
11/2019 – 7/2021
Tätigkeitsbeschreibung
Trainer bei -Hyperlink entfernt- und bei der MdynamiX AG
Abhalten von Kursen
Themengebiete: Python, NumPy, Matplotlib, Pandas, Machine-Learning
Deeplearning4j, Pandas, Python
4/2019 – 6/2019
Tätigkeitsbeschreibung
Daten aus einem Datenlogger (AiM Tech) lesen, aufbereiten und als Excel-Daten bereitstellen
Eingesetzte Technologien und Methodiken: Python, CTypes, XlsxWriter, Matplotlib, NumPy, Pandas
Pandas, Simulink, Python
9/2017 – 3/2018
Tätigkeitsbeschreibung
Im Fall- und Winterterm die Vorlesung „Fundamentals in Computer Science I“ am Department of Computer Science gehalten - 3 Stunden Vorlesung und 3 Stunden Praktikum je Woche
Inhalt der Vorlesung – Einführung in die Programmiersprache Python
Linux Entwicklung, Python
9/2015 – 2/2017
Tätigkeitsbeschreibung
Konvertierung eines komplexen MATLAB-Programms (Berechnung von „Objektiven Parametern“ für das Fahrgefühl in einem Fahrzeug) nach C. Erstellung einer DLL, so dass die Funktionalität der MATLAB-Anwendung über die DLL verfügbar ist.
Test und Dokumentation der DLL
C/al, Tool Command Language, C#, Simulink
10/2012 – 8/2015
Tätigkeitsbeschreibung
Entwicklung eines Tools zum Management von Daten, Programmen und Anwendungen für die Entwicklung in der Automobilindustrie
Entwicklung einer GUI basierend auf JavaFX für das Management von Daten und Projekten
Webapplikation (basierend auf Tomcat) zur Verwaltung von Lizenzen
Apache Tomcat, Eclipse, Eclipse Modeling Framework, Git, Java (allg.), JavaFX, Junit
4/2001 – 2/2010
Tätigkeitsbeschreibung
Entwicklung eines generischen Tools zur Testautomatisierung für den Einsatz in der Telekommunikation (z.B. Router, NodeB, RNC, Mobiles).
Design, Implementierung, Test, Dokumentation und Anwenderschulung.
Speicherung des Messageflows zwischen Testgeräten und Testobjekten bei LTE-Anwendungen. Speicherung des Messageflows in einer SQL-Datenbank. Graphische Darstellung des Messageflows
Verbesserung der Loggingfunktionalität für das Testautomatisierungstool Pegasus – Design, Implementierung und Test der Loggingfunktionalität
Java Database Connectivity, C, Eclipse, Java (allg.), Java Architecture for XML Binding (JAXB), Junit, Rich-Client, XML, XSD (XML Schema Definition)
Zertifikate
Stanford Online
MIT
Persönliche Daten
- Deutsch (Muttersprache)
- Englisch (Fließend)
- Europäische Union
Kontaktdaten
Nur registrierte PREMIUM-Mitglieder von freelance.de können Kontaktdaten einsehen.
Jetzt Mitglied werden